Hey, it's kinda' metal.

I made the 5 hour drive to Birmingham, Al. When I walked into the arena they were playing Criss' hidden track on the Sirens Silver cd over the PA. Very cool, although I had to wonder how many people here had a clue who he was. That was my first impression. The crowd was was different than I thought they would be. I had to be happy for the guys. 12,500 people were there.

I think anybody who likes music would like this show. the violin chick is amazing. Angnus Clark and Al Pitrelli did a guitar duel and played off the crowd. The narrator could read Full metal jacket's post, and make it look like a nobel prize winner. The highlight for me was seeing Johnny Lee Middleton up there in front of all those people. Everything was just great, and then Al introduced Tommy Shaw, and he came out and played some Styx songs, and did Sarajevo with TSO. Very cool.

I just couldn't help but think of Savatage and what they have become. I was wondering if these grandparents had any clue, that the orgin of this band, was a band that sang a song called Necrophilia.

Overall, I got way more than my money's worth.
